Abstract

The subject of this paper is the robust and quality-oriented design of an electromagnetic wave absorber. Taguchi's parameter design is employed first to optimize the absorption efficiency of the wave absorber over a wide bandwidth while reducing the sensitivity of the optimized performance to a number of hard-to-control variables. However, the variation of the optimized product performance after Taguchi's parameter design might not be within the desired target due to certain design requirements and market expectations. Therefore, a new design scheme is studied with the employment of Taguchi's tolerance design. The results illustrate that the absorption efficiency could be further enhanced by tightening the performance variation level, so that the quality of the absorber is improved.
